Choosing the Right Roof Bars
When it comes to choosing roof bars for your VW Transporter T6, there are a few key factors to consider The first thing to think about is the weight capacity of the bars – you’ll want to make sure that they can safely support the items you plan to transport It’s also important to consider the length and width of the bars, as well as any additional features such as locking mechanisms or aerodynamic designs.
Another important consideration is the type of mounting system used to attach the roof bars to your vehicle There are several different options available, including roof rails, rain gutters, and door frame mounts roof bars vw transporter t6. Each type of mounting system has its own advantages and disadvantages, so it’s important to choose one that is compatible with your VW Transporter T6 and meets your specific needs.
Installing Roof Bars
Once you’ve chosen the right roof bars for your VW Transporter T6, it’s time to install them Although the process may seem daunting at first, most roof bars are relatively easy to install with just a few basic tools The first step is to determine the best location for the bars on your vehicle – you’ll want to make sure they are evenly spaced and securely attached to the roof.
Next, you’ll need to follow the manufacturer’s instructions for mounting the bars This may involve attaching brackets to the roof rails or door frames, securing the bars in place, and tightening any bolts or screws It’s important to double-check that the bars are securely attached before loading any cargo onto them, as a loose or improperly installed roof bar could pose a safety hazard while driving.
